Robbery suspect leads authorities on high-speed chase with baby in the back seat
A robbery suspect from Hawthorne led deputies and police on a high-speed chase while a baby sat in his car Wednesday afternoon.The alleged robbery happened in Beverly Hills. The Hawthorne Police Department started the pursuit before the suspects jumped out of the car. However, one of them allegedly jumped into another car. The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department said it initially helped the Hawthorne police track the suspects but eventually took over the pursuit.While the chase started in Hawthrone, the driver led deputies and police into the West LA area. Mother of Raejonette Morgan meets with LA County sheriff and speaks out
The mother of Raejonette Morgan spoke out Wednesday after meeting with Los Angeles County Sheriff Robert Luna, nearly two weeks after a deputy's response to her daughter's killing drew criticism from her and others.On July 2, Morgan was found shot to death inside a car riddled in bullet holes near the West Athens neighborhood in South Los Angeles.
